Molly O’Donoghue and Louis Laville’s Victory: Molly O’Donoghue and Louis Laville won their quarterfinal match in the Pro Mixed Doubles category at the 2025 PPA Tour Australia’s Perth Pickleball Open on May 10. The pair easily defeated Michelle Russ and Michael Russ with a dominant score of 15-4.
This win for O’Donoghue and Laville ensures their place in the semifinals of the prestigious event, marking an important step in their pursuit of a title at the tournament.
